Internal Memo — Proposed Franchise Agreement, Thornvale Region

To all heads of department: the draft franchise agreement with Bramwick Holdings has completed legal review. Key terms include a seven-year licence, territory exclusivity within Thornvale, and staged royalty rates. Department heads should assess operational readiness and report concerns before Thursday's sign-off session. Please handle all related documents with care. The confidential planning note appears immediately below.

board note of hahaf-fahog: The pricing group signed off on a budget of $229.3 million for Project Aldius.

Subject: Renewal of Corporate Insurance Programme — Detailed Summary

Dear colleagues,

Our combined policy with Arbenfield Assurance is due for renewal on 30 April. The proposed premium reflects a 7.4% increase, driven chiefly by revised flood-risk ratings at the Colmere warehouse. Cover limits remain unchanged; the deductible on marine cargo rises slightly. Finance should accrue the difference from Q2 onward and confirm the payment schedule with treasury.

A full broker comparison is attached for review.

The note below explains the timing.

board note of yagap-fahop: The northern region missed its Julix quota by 6.7 percent last quarter. Goroxix Partners plans to raise the Caswyn list price by 6.7 percent in April. The board signed off on a budget of $201.2 million for Project Gilath. The renewal with Zoriusax Group closes at $431.5 million a year, 51.5 percent below the last contract.

We have received a term sheet from our distribution partner, Calder & Wynn Trading, covering exclusive resale of the Nimbral platform across three inland territories. Key terms: a two-year commitment, tiered volume rebates, and a joint marketing fund. Legal review completes next week; until then, do not discuss exclusivity with prospects in those territories. Forecast assumptions for Q3 should exclude partner-sourced pipeline pending signature. The strategic rationale for accepting these terms is set out in the confidential note below.

board note of kageg-bahof: The renewal with Holwynax Holdings closes at $2 million a year, 5 percent below the last contract. Project Ulaath slips by two quarters because of the supplier delay.